King Edward potatoes are a classic all-rounder - grown in the UK since 1902, they taste great and store well. Named after King Edward VII - they originated in the same year of his coronation - they can be found in all high street supermarkets, and in many allotments and back gardens.

Desiree potato. King Edward. These classic, regal potatoes are not only king in name, but king in nature. They are, by far, the best common variety for that holiest of holy of recipes: roast potatoes. This is because they are super floury, meaning that all that starch transforms into wispy fluff when it meets its fate in the oven.

King Edward is a starchy potato like Maris Piper. You can use King Edward potatoes in place of Maris Piper for cooked applications such as mashing, boiling, baking, or chipping, roasting. Charlotte Potatoes. Firm and waxy, Charlotte potatoes have a subtle taste. Perfect for boiling and adding to salads. Jersey Royal Potatoes. Small, waxy potatoes, Jersey Royals are best served boiled, buttered and doused in herbs. King Edward Potatoes. Typically with a splash of pink to them, King Edwards are a floury potato with all-round appeal.
